深入探讨Web3节点的多重签
2025-10-27
随着区块链技术的持续发展,Web3的兴起为去中心化的应用程序提供了全新的可能性。在Web3生态系统中,节点扮演着至关重要的角色,特别是在安全性方面。多重签名技术则为节点的安全提供了一个强有力的保障。多重签名能够确保在进行交易时,必须得到多个授权方的同意,从而大幅度降低欺诈和各种安全风险。这篇文章将详细探讨Web3节点的多重签名技术及其在实际应用中的意义。
多重签名是一种密码学技术,允许多个用户共同签署一笔交易。与传统的单签名系统相比,多重签名要求多个授权者共同参与,以确保任何交易的合法性和安全性。在区块链环境中,多重签名能够有效避免单点故障问题,降低资金被盗的风险。
多重签名的基础是门限签名方案(Threshold Signature Scheme),即在N个可用签名者中,M个签名者的签名可以构成有效的交易。通过设置不同的M和N值,用户可以灵活调整安全级别,以适应不同的应用需求。
Web3节点的多重签名技术在多个场景中展现出其重要性。以下是一些主要的应用场景:
多重签名技术为Web3节点带来了众多优势,但同时也面临着一些挑战。
首先,多重签名有效提升了安全性,减少了因单个私钥泄露而导致的风险。其次,它极大地增强了资金的可控制性,只有在满足相应条件的情况下,资金才能转出。此外,多重签名还促进了透明性,因为每一个签名都是公开可查的,增加了对财务管理的信任。
尽管如此,多重签名也并非完美无缺。一方面,实施多重签名需要一定的技术门槛和成本,对于普通用户来说,可能面临操作复杂的问题;另一方面,在某些情况下,签名者的分散可能导致效率低下,例如在紧急情况下,无法及时获得足够的签名,从而影响交易的时效性。
实现Web3节点的多重签名并不是一项简单的任务,涉及多个层面的技术考虑。通常,步骤可以总结为以下几个方面:
多重签名通过要求多个用户授权才能进行交易,显著提升了资产安全性。没有任何单一的私钥控制整个资产,降低了遭受攻击或被盗的风险。例如,在一次针对大型交易所的黑客攻击中,攻击者可能会成功获取单个管理员的私钥,但很难在已设置多个授权者的情况下,同时获取到多个用户的授权。
此外,多重签名还可以用于保护合约的管理权限,确保任何更改或资金的转移都必须经过多个管理者的同意。这种机制增强了对合约的控制力,避免了因个别人员的失误或恶意行为导致的资产损失。
选择合适的门限值是多重签名设计中的关键。通常情况下,如果N过小,可能无法有效防护;而如果M过大,则可能在紧急情况下无法快速达成协议。选择合适的门限值需要考虑以下几个方面:
确保多重签名的高可用性和效率可以通过多个手段实现:
多重签名的设计应根据用途和需求的不同而灵活调整。例如,企业资产管理和个人资产管理就有不同的考量。
总之,对不同用户的需求展开充分调研,对于多重签名的设计至关重要。
未来,多重签名技术将继续向更安全、更智能的方向发展。我们可以预见到以下几种趋势:
随着Web3的发展,多重签名技术必将不断演进,为传统安全问题提供新的解决方案。
多重签名在Web3节点中的应用,不仅提升了安全性,还促进了去中心化金融与其他应用的发展。尽管面临挑战,但其优点使其成为区块链技术演进过程中不可或缺的一部分。随着技术的进步和用户需求的不断变化,我们可以期待多重签名在未来带来更多创新和应用方向。